Appearance

Gas Weeds often produces dense, compact flowers that resemble golf balls or spears. These buds are typically covered in a thick layer of trichomes, giving them a glistening appearance. Colors can range from green to deep purple, often accented by orange pistils.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ma of Gas Weeds is characterized by its pungent, fuel-like scent, reminiscent of diesel exhaust, skunk, and pepper. Flavors follow suit, with notes of citrus, diesel, earth, and mint, often leaving a lingering pepper-fuel aftertaste.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

Gas Weeds typically features a terpene profile rich in beta-caryophyllene, myrcene, and limonene, which contribute to its distinct aroma and effects. It is noted for its high THC content, often exceeding 20%, with minimal CBD.

Origins & Lineage

As a member of the 'gas' family, Gas Weeds likely traces its lineage back to foundational strains such as ChemDog, Sour Diesel, or OG Kush, known for their potent, fuel-forward characteristics. These classic lines have been influential in developing modern cultivars with similar aromatic and sensory profiles.

What does 'gas' mean in cannabis terms?
In cannabis slang, 'gas' refers to a pungent, fuel-like aroma, often compared to diesel exhaust, skunk, or solvents. It signifies a potent and aromatic strain.
